    Here is the deal:

    I have the "perfect name" for my next website. Unfortunately, the .com domain for this name is "for sale" at $2,588. This is a bit more than I can afford right now.

    Instead, I purchased the .net version for less than $10. Now I'm at a crossroads.

    Do I use the .net and have my perfect name, or do I settle for a different name with a .com extension?

    Please help...I can't decide. I really hate these companies that buy up thousands of domains just to turn around and sell them.

    I wouldn't go for the .net version but instead I'll choose another domain name that's available in its .com extention. You see, that domain name you want to buy might be perfect, but when your site grows big, you'll automatically lose visitors when they accidentally remember "yourdomain.com" instead of your site at .net ;)

    I would only get the .net if it was a really generic keyword term (like blackjackets.net) but not if it were a made up or branded term (like jacketpro.net). The .com owner is always going to have a 1up on you, unfortunately.
